Russia test-launches latest ballistic missile of Bulava
font size    

Russia's Northern Fleet has successfully test-launched a newly-developed R-30 ballistic missile, with multiple independent reentry vehicles forming the core of the new Bulava submarine-launched ballistic missile system (SS-NX-30), the Interfax news agency reported on Wednesday.

"The missile is part of the fourth generation Bulava naval missile system," Defense Minister Sergei Ivanov said at a Wednesday meeting in Moscow on occasion of the 60th anniversary of the Russian nuclear industry.

Ivanov in his speech praised the harmonization of the new submarine-launched ballistic missile system with the ground- launched strategic missile system, saying it was a distinctive feature of Bulava.

He noted that the new missile system was fully designed and built by the Russian defense industry.

According to Ivanov, the missile was fired from Dmitri Donskoy nuclear-powered strategic submarine in surface condition.

"The missile carried out its mission and hit its target in the Kamchatka firing range," he said.

He also pointed out that the successful test of the advanced missile should owe to the experts who have made "unique solutions" in the nuclear industry.
